Protein Name | Cytochrome b-c1 complex subunit Rieske, mitochondrial |
Protein Synonyms/Alias | Complex III subunit 5; Cytochrome b-c1 complex subunit 5; Liver regeneration-related protein LRRGT00195; Rieske iron-sulfur protein; RISP; Ubiquinol-cytochrome c reductase iron-sulfur subunit; Cytochrome b-c1 complex subunit 11; Complex III subunit IX; Ubiquinol-cytochrome c reductase 8 kDa protein |
Gene Name | Uqcrfs1 |

Functional Description | Component of the ubiquinol-cytochrome c reductase complex (complex III or cytochrome b-c1 complex), which is a respiratory chain that generates an electrochemical potential coupled to ATP synthesis. |
Sequence Annotation | DOMAIN 187 272 Rieske. METAL 217 217 Iron-sulfur (2Fe-2S) (By similarity). METAL 219 219 Iron-sulfur (2Fe-2S); via pros nitrogen METAL 236 236 Iron-sulfur (2Fe-2S) (By similarity). METAL 239 239 Iron-sulfur (2Fe-2S); via pros nitrogen DISULFID 222 238 By similarity. |
